11.10.2.3

Measuring the operate value for the zero-sequence function

Measure the operate value for the zero-sequence function, if included in the IED.
1.
Simulate normal operating conditions with the three-phase currents in phase with their
corresponding phase voltages and with all of them equal to their rated values.
2.
Slowly decrease the measured voltage in one phase until the BLKU signal appears.
3.
Record the measured voltage and calculate the corresponding zero-sequence voltage
according to the equation (observe that the voltages in the equation are phasors):
3 U
IEC00000276 V1 EN-US
Where:
IEC00000275 V1 EN-US
4.
Compare the result with the set value of the zero-sequence operating voltage (consider that the
set value 3U0> is in percentage of the base voltage.)
